Media & Content Management for Creative Studios
A media production company required a high-performance NAS for storing and editing 4K video content. Our custom Mini-ITX board with dual 10GbE ports and RAID 10 setup supported seamless real-time editing, reducing workflow bottlenecks by 50%.
Large-Scale Surveillance Data Storage
A security provider required an efficient NAS to store continuous video surveillance footage. We provided a solution with 12TB drives and enhanced data throughput, enabling uninterrupted 24/7 recording with 40% less downtime.
Healthcare Data Archiving
A healthcare provider needed a secure, scalable NAS for storing patient records and medical images. Our custom storage solution, using SSD caching and RAID 5, boosted data retrieval speeds by 30% and ensured HIPAA compliance.
Backup and Disaster Recovery for Financial Institutions
A bank required a fault-tolerant NAS solution for secure, rapid backup and disaster recovery. Our board with dual 10GbE and NVMe SSD cache significantly reduced recovery time by 60%, ensuring business continuity.
